How to Care for Your Beard in Cold Weather: Winter Beard Care Tips

How to Care for Your Beard in Cold Weather: Winter Beard Care Tips

 

Introduction:

 

Cold weather can be harsh on your beard, leading to dryness, brittleness, and even beard dandruff. Winter’s lower humidity and cold winds can sap moisture from both your beard and the skin underneath, making proper care even more essential during this season. In this post, I’ll share key tips for keeping your beard healthy, soft, and protected during the colder months.

 

1. Hydrate Your Beard Daily with Beard Oil

 

Cold air can dry out your beard, leaving it brittle and prone to breakage. Applying beard oil daily helps lock in moisture and prevents your beard from becoming dry and itchy. Choose a beard oil that’s rich in hydrating ingredients like jojoba oil, avocado oil, and argan oil to nourish both your beard and the skin underneath.

2. Use Beard Balm for Extra Protection and Hold

 

Beard balm not only moisturizes your beard but also forms a protective barrier against cold winds and harsh winter conditions. It helps seal in moisture and provides light hold, keeping your beard neat and protected throughout the day. Beard balm is especially useful for thicker or longer beards that need extra care in cold weather.

3. Avoid Washing Your Beard Too Frequently

 

Over-washing your beard in winter can strip it of its natural oils, leading to dryness and irritation. Instead, wash your beard 2-3 times a week using a gentle, moisturizing beard soap. On non-wash days, simply rinse your beard with water and follow up with beard oil to keep it hydrated.

4. Exfoliate Gently to Prevent Beard Dandruff

 

Cold weather can lead to dry, flaky skin underneath your beard, resulting in beard dandruff. Exfoliating your beard 2-3 times a week with a gentle beard brush helps remove dead skin cells and prevents dandruff. It also stimulates blood flow to the hair follicles, promoting healthier growth.

 

Tip: Use a soft beard brush to gently exfoliate the skin under your beard and prevent flakes.

5. Protect Your Beard from Harsh Winter Winds

 

Cold winds can be especially damaging to your beard, causing tangles, breakage, and dryness. Wearing a scarf or high-collared jacket can help protect your beard from direct exposure to wind and cold. For extra protection, apply a layer of beard balm before heading outdoors to shield your beard from the elements.

 

Tip: Use a beard balm with beeswax or shea butter for a protective barrier against wind.

6. Keep Your Beard Trimmed to Prevent Split Ends

 

The combination of cold weather and dryness can lead to split ends, especially if your beard is longer. Regular trimming helps remove damaged ends and keeps your beard looking healthy and neat. Trim your beard every 4-6 weeks during winter to prevent breakage and maintain its shape.

 

Tip: Use sharp beard scissors to trim split ends and maintain your beard’s health.

8. Use a Humidifier to Add Moisture to the Air

 

Indoor heating systems can dry out the air, which in turn can dry out your beard. Using a humidifier in your home helps add moisture back into the air, preventing your beard from becoming dry and brittle. This is especially important if you live in a particularly cold or dry climate.

 

Tip: Place a humidifier in your bedroom or living area to maintain moisture levels and keep your beard hydrated.
